The Under 17 Car Club

I also found an awesome club called “The Under 17 Car Club”. Essentially it’s a car club where anyone from 11 up can bring or borrow a car to practise driving in realistic scenarios, The Under 17 Car Club’s aim and main goal is to make young drivers more aware and safe on the road, they can do this by giving them years of experience in hundreds of vehicles before they even take their driving test. We went to one of the open days there for an in depth look at how the club works, we found that the people that attend to the club are so confident and calm behind the wheel that they even showed us round track in our car!
